CAL UNITED STRIKERS FC ROUND OUT GOALKEEPING CORPS 

Club signs Mitch North and Jean Antoine to join Steven Barrera 

 

ORANGE COUNTY, CA – California United Strikers FC announced the signings of a pair of experienced goalkeepers on Wednesday. The additions bring a full complement of three legitimate number ones to the roster.
 

Cal United Strikers FC have always been known for their offensive prowess, but it was Wednesday's announcement that may have one of the more significant impacts this season. The club announced the signing of two new goalkeepers that will ensure head coach, Don Ebert and goalkeeper coach, Ludovic Antunes have a bit of a selection headache on their hands. 
 

Mitch North, 26 is a Jacksonville, Oregon native. He played with the Timbers Academy before embarking on his college career at Oregon State, later transferring to Sonoma State. “Mitch is a great communicator,” said Antunes. “He is very demanding. He is good technically with strong reflexes and feet.” Mitch will be added to the roster upon the receipt of his ITC.
 

Haitian born Jean Antoine, a third-year pro, joins Cal United Strikers FC from rivals 1904 FC. The towering shot stopper also spent time with fellow NISA club, Detroit City FC backstopping them in their NISA Cup Championship. Known for his quick reflexes and aerial prowess, he also had quick stints with Monterrey Flash and San Diego Sockers in the MASL. “Jean has a great presence due to his size. He has obvious athletic qualities and is strong in 1v1 situations,” complimented Antunes.  
 

The newly minted pair will join incumbent Steven “Bear” Barrera who famously led the club to lifting the 2019 NISA West Coast Championship trophy. A night where Barrera forever etched his name in the Cal United Strikers history books by standing tall in the penalty shootout. “Steven is a good goalkeeper with technical skills and explosive qualities. He’s a good goalie on the line,” added Antunes.  


 
 

As a proud Antunes described his goalkeepers, the common thread amongst all three was their commitment to training and teamwork. Over the first six weeks of preseason, the three keepers have been working tirelessly challenging and supporting one another. Ebert and Antunes may have a problem on their hands, but it is one a lot of coaches would envy, as these three have shown there really is no wrong answer.
